using Printf #
"""
mutable struct LinkedInts
next :: Vector{Int}
prev :: Vector{Int}
back :: Vector{Int}
free_ptr :: Int
free_cap :: Int
root :: Int
block :: Vector{Int}
size :: Vector{Int}
end
Block linked list, there are `length(next) = length(prev)` indices, `free_cap`
of which are free and the other are used. `root` gives the last one used, i.e.
starting from `root` and following `prev` until it gives zero should give the
`length(prev) - free_cap` used indices. Similarly, `free_ptr` gives the last
free index, i.e. starting from `free_ptr` and following `prev` until it gives
zero should give the `free_cap` free indices.
We always have `length(next) == length(prev) == length(back)`.
* `next[i]` is the minimum `j > i` such that `j` is used, or 0 if `i` is the
last one used, i.e. `i = root`.
* `prev[i]` is the maximum `j < i` such that `j` is used, or 0 if `i` is the
first one used.
* `back[i]` is such that `block[back[i]]` is the first index of the block
in which `i` is.
* `free_cap` is the number of free slots.
* `free_ptr` last index of the `free_cap` free slots.
* `root` last used index.
We always have `length(block) == length(size)`.
* `block`: mapping from block index to first index of the block
* `size`: mapping from block index to length of the block
"""
mutable struct LinkedInts
next :: Vector{Int}
prev :: Vector{Int}
back :: Vector{Int}
free_ptr :: Int
free_cap :: Int
root :: Int
block :: Vector{Int}
size :: Vector{Int}
end
function LinkedInts(capacity=128)
return LinkedInts(Int[], Int[], Int[],
0, 0, 0,
Int[], Int[])
end
allocatedlist(s::LinkedInts) = findall(s.block .> 0)
allocated(s::LinkedInts, id :: Int) = id > 0 && id <= length(s.block) && s.block[id] > 0
blocksize(s::LinkedInts, id :: Int) = s.size[id]
Base.length(s::LinkedInts) = length(s.next)
numblocks(s::LinkedInts) = length(s.block)
function Base.show(f::IO, s::LinkedInts)
print(f,"LinkedInts(\n")
@printf(f," Number of blocks: %d\n", length(s.block))
@printf(f," Number of elements: %d\n", length(s.next))
print(f," Blocks:\n")
for i in 1:length(s.block)
if s.block[i] > 0
idxs = getindexes(s,i)
print(f," #$i: $idxs\n")
end
end
p = s.free_ptr
freelst = Int[]
while p > 0
push!(freelst,p)
p = s.prev[p]
end
print(f," Free: $freelst\n")
println(f," free_ptr = $(s.free_ptr)")
println(f," root = $(s.root)")
println(f," next = $(s.next)")
println(f," prev = $(s.prev)")
print(f,")")
end
"""
ensurefree(s::LinkedInts, N :: Int)
Ensure that there are at least `N` elements free, and allocate as necessary.
"""
function ensurefree(s::LinkedInts, N :: Int)
if s.free_cap < N
num = N - s.free_cap
cap = length(s.next)
first = cap+1
last = cap+num
append!(s.next, Int[i+1 for i in first:last])
append!(s.prev, Int[i-1 for i in first:last])
append!(s.back, zeros(Int, num))
s.next[last] = 0
s.prev[first] = s.free_ptr
if s.prev[first] > 0
s.next[s.prev[first]] = first
end
s.free_ptr = last
s.free_cap += num
return num
else
return 0
end
end
function allocate_block(s::LinkedInts, N::Int, id::Integer)
@assert(N > 0)
ensurefree(s, N)
# remove from free list
ptre = s.free_ptr
# ptre is the last index
ptrb = ptre
for i = 1:N-1
s.back[ptrb] = id
ptrb = s.prev[ptrb]
end
s.back[ptrb] = id
s.block[id] = ptrb
# ptrb is the first index
prev = s.prev[ptrb]
if prev > 0
s.next[prev] = 0
end
s.free_ptr = s.prev[ptrb]
s.free_cap -= N
# insert into list `idx`
s.prev[ptrb] = s.root
if s.root > 0
s.next[s.root] = ptrb
end
s.root = ptre
#if ! checkconsistency(s)
# println("List = ",s)
# assert(false)
#end
return id
end
function create_block(s::LinkedInts, N::Int)
@assert(N > 0)
push!(s.size, N)
push!(s.block, 0)
@assert length(s.size) == length(s.block)
return length(s.block)
end
"""
newblock(s::LinkedInts, N :: Int)
Add a new block in list `idx`
"""
function newblock(s::LinkedInts, N::Int)::Int
id = create_block(s, N)
allocate_block(s, N, id)
return id
end
"""
Move a block to the free list.
"""
function deleteblock(s::LinkedInts, id :: Int)
if s.size[id] > 0
ptrb = s.block[id]
N = s.size[id]
ptre = ptrb
s.back[ptre] = 0
for i in 2:N
ptre = s.next[ptre]
s.back[ptre] = 0
end
prev = s.prev[ptrb]
next = s.next[ptre]
# remove from list and clear the block id
if s.root == ptre s.root = prev end
if prev > 0 s.next[prev] = next end
if next > 0 s.prev[next] = prev end
s.size[id] = 0
s.block[id] = 0
# add to free list
if s.free_ptr > 0
s.next[s.free_ptr] = ptrb
end
s.prev[ptrb] = s.free_ptr
s.free_ptr = ptre
s.next[ptre] = 0
s.free_cap += N
end
end
# TODO merge getoneindex and getindex
function getoneindex(s::LinkedInts, id :: Int)
N = s.size[id]
if N < 1
error("No values at id")
end
s.block[i]
end
"""
getindex(s::LinkedInts, id::Int)
Shortcut for `getindexes(s, id)[1]` when `s.size[id]` is 1.
"""
function getindex(s::LinkedInts, id::Int)
@assert s.size[id] == 1
@assert s.back[s.block[id]] == id
return s.block[id]
end
"""
getindexes(s::LinkedInts, id :: Int)
Return the vector of indices for the block `id`.
"""
function getindexes(s::LinkedInts, id :: Int)
@assert length(s.next) == length(s.prev) == length(s.back)
N = s.size[id]
r = Vector{Int}(undef, N)
p = s.block[id]
for i in 1:N
@assert s.back[p] == id
r[i] = p
p = s.next[p]
end
return r
end
function getindexes(s::LinkedInts, id::Int, target::Vector{Int}, offset::Int)
N = s.size[id]
p = s.block[id]
for i in 1:N
@assert s.back[p] == id
target[i+offset-1] = p
p = s.next[p]
end
return N
end
function getindexes(s::LinkedInts, ids::Vector{Int})
N = sum(map(id -> s.size[id], ids))
r = Vector{Int}(undef,N)
offset = 1
for id in ids
offset += getindexes(s, id, r, offset)
end
return r
end
"""
Get a list if the currently free elements.
"""
function getfreeindexes(s::LinkedInts)
N = s.free_cap
r = Array{Int}(undef,N)
ptr = s.free_ptr
for i in 1:N
@assert iszero(s.back[ptr])
r[N-i+1] = ptr
ptr = s.prev[ptr]
end
r
end
"""
Get a list if the currently used elements.
"""
function getusedindexes(s::LinkedInts)
N = length(s.next) - s.free_cap
r = Array{Int}(undef,N)
ptr = s.root
for i in 1:N
@assert !iszero(s.back[ptr])
r[N-i+1] = ptr
ptr = s.prev[ptr]
end
r
end
"""
Check consistency of the internal structures.
"""
function checkconsistency(s::LinkedInts) :: Bool
if length(s.prev) != length(s.next)
return false
end
N = length(s.prev)
if ! (all(i -> s.prev[i] == 0 || s.next[s.prev[i]] == i, 1:N) &&
all(i -> s.next[i] == 0 || s.prev[s.next[i]] == i, 1:N))
@assert(false)
end
mark = fill(false,length(s.prev))
p = s.free_ptr
while p != 0
@assert iszero(s.back[ptr])
mark[p] = true
p = s.prev[p]
end
p = s.root
while p != 0
@assert(!mark[p])
@assert !iszero(s.back[ptr])
mark[p] = true
p = s.prev[p]
end
if !all(mark)
println(s)
println(mark)
@assert(all(mark))
end
return true
end
